[ARCHIVED] Lake County Sheriff’s Office Speed Awareness Campaign Nets 83 Citations

Lake County, IL – Lake County Sheriff’s deputies issued a total of 83 speeding citations within 24 hours, beginning July 25, during a Speed Awareness Traffic Safety Campaign. The Lake County Sheriff’s Office is taking a proactive approach to promote safety for motorists, pedestrians, and cyclists through both education and enforcement.  

According to illinoisspeedawarenessday.org, speed accounted for the following outcomes in 2016:

  • Speed accounted for 32.2% of all crashes
  • Speed accounted for 34.2% of all fatal crashes
  • Speed accounted for 37.8% of injury crashes

Sheriff Mark Curran stated, “Lives can be saved by obeying speed limits and understanding how speeding impacts a crash. Slow down and arrive alive.”
